The symbol _ZNSt8ios_base7failureB5cxx11C1EPKcRKSt10error_code, which appears in libstdc++, was being demangled as std::ios_base::failure[abi:cxx11]::cxx11(char const*, std::error_code const&) That is clearly incorrect: std::ios_base::failure does not have a method cxx11, and anyhow if you look closely at the mangled name you will see that it is supposed to be a constructor. This patch fixes the demangler to generate the correct demangling, namely std::ios_base::failure[abi:cxx11]::failure(char const*, std::error_code const&) Bootstrapped and ran libiberty and libstdc++-v3 tests on x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u. Committed to mainline. Ian 2015-08-15 Ian Lance Taylor <iant@google.com> * cp-demangle.c (d_abi_tags): Preserve di->last_name across any ABI tags.
